POE ExxonMobil 6202 is a high‑performance polyolefin elastomer. Manufactured with metallocene catalyst technology, it is well‑recognized for outstanding elasticity, toughness and good compatibility with other materials.

Main Applications

Film Applications: Especially suitable for cast films and packaging films. It endows films with favorable elasticity, toughness and high transparency.

Polymer Modification: Frequently used as a toughener for plastics such as polypropylene (PP). It significantly improves the impact resistance of base materials without excessive sacrifice of flowability and rigidity.

Other Fields: Also applicable for automotive interior and exterior parts, non‑woven fabrics, personal hygiene products, wires and cables, etc.

Detailed Physical Properties

Property Category Test Item Data Unit Test Standard
Physical Properties Density (23°C) 0.863 g/cm³ ASTM D1505
  Melt Flow Rate (190°C/2.16 kg) 9.1 g/10 min ASTM D1238
  Melt Flow Rate (230°C/2.16 kg) 20 g/10 min Internal Test Method
Mechanical Properties Flexural Modulus (1% Secant) 12.3 MPa ASTM D790
  Tensile Strength (Break) >5.50 MPa ASTM D638
  Tensile Strength (100% Strain) 1.93 MPa ASTM D638
  Tensile Strength (300% Strain) 2.10 MPa ASTM D638
  Elongation at Break >2000 % ASTM D638
  Tear Strength (Die‑C) 33.3 kN/m ASTM D624
Hardness Shore A Hardness 66 ASTM D2240

Processing Parameters

Processing Step Parameter Recommendation / Description
Drying Treatment Drying is generally not required. Dry at 70‑80°C for 2‑3 hours if the material gets damp.
Processing Temperature Initial temperature is recommended to be approx. 10°C above melting point; adjust according to processing methods.
Melt Flow Rate (MFR) 9.1 g/10 min (190°C/2.16 kg).
Injection Speed High processing speed is acceptable.
Mold Temperature Slightly higher mold temperature and pressure are generally preferred during processing.
